The new range of Tracer Extrasil packings has been specially developed to replace one of the most popular packings on the market (WS).
All the physical and chromatographic parameters evaluated show a total equivalence between both materials, and what is more important, this has been certified by the excellent results obtained by the many users who upto now have tried this packing.
